Barry wasteful as Villa held

The England midfielder, who has vowed to remain with Villa until at least next summer, could have had a hat-trick but his finishing deserted him.
For Roy Hodgson's Fulham, a second successive away point against top-four opposition leaves them unbeaten in four and moves them into eighth place.
Barry missed the first decent chance of the game after 24 minutes. Ashley Young was the creator with an inswinging cross which was met by the England midfielder at the far post but he directed his header just wide.
Young had a half-chance when Gabriel Agbonlahor squared the ball to him on the edge of the box but he summed up proceedings by shooting high over Mark Schwarzer's goal.
Steve Sidwell was also guilty of a glaring miss after 39 minutes when it looked easier to score. Young arrowed in a free-kick from 30 yards out and Sidwell timed his run perfectly to find himself unmarked six yards out but he headed over when he needed only the deftest of touches.
Villa goalkeeper Brad Friedel was called into meaningful action for the first time two minutes later to tip over a 20-yarder from Clint Dempsey.
Schwarzer came to Fulham's rescue when he tipped a close-range header from Barry onto the crossbar from another dangerous Young free-kick.
Friedel then parried away a fierce angled drive from Simon Davies at the expense of a corner.
Barry missed another good chance when he headed across the goal when unmarked from a Young free-kick, as the game petered out into a frustrating stalemate.
